创建分页HTML/js/jQuery数据网格的好方法是什么,其中每个页面都可以轻松地被google抓取?我知道我需要从HTML网格开始,然后使用渐进式增强将它变成带有javascript的东西(一旦页面加载,然后是jqgrid'stableToGrid或kendoUIgrid'sinitializationfromtable之类的东西)会将HTML更新为漂亮的javascript网格)。所以我很高兴知道网格的第一页可以被谷歌读取,因为它首先以HTML加载。但是分页呢?我是否需要加载一组分页的HTML链接,然后在渐进式增强加载javascript网格后隐藏这些页码?我如何确保谷歌扫描分页
我知道我可以反其道而行之,并让server.com/#!/mystuff成为可ajax抓取的,但我想知道是否可以反其道而行之。如果我有server.com/mystuff并将重定向发送到server.com/#!/mystuff,那么google爬虫是否会通过重命名过程运行该url,以便它跟随重定向到server.com/?escaped_fragment=mystuff? 最佳答案 根据网站管理员工具,没有[1]。Question:WhenshouldIuse_escaped_fragment_andwhenshouldIuse#
我在mvc5上有音乐网站,并且有一些页面包含艺术家信息和音乐轨道,这些页面由表中的ajax加载。例如这个页面http://freemusiclib.com/artist/Rihanna问题是谷歌看不到ajax表的内容http://webcache.googleusercontent.com/search?q=cache:ZtBOGAwtc84J:freemusiclib.com/artist/Rihanna+&cd=1&hl=en&ct=clnk&gl=us使它对google蜘蛛友好并为用户保留基于ajax的最佳实践是什么?想法#1因为该表是从服务器端加载的,所以我可以制作一些切换器a
是否存在使用googlebot索引AJAX内容的技术?我的意思是,是否可以在javascript中声明一个机器人将调用并执行以获取页面内容的方法? 最佳答案 没有。处理这个问题的明智方法是创建真实的页面来表达文档在使用JavaScript操作后所处的状态,正常链接到它们,然后progressivelyenhance使用JavaScript来:Cancelthenormalaction的链接ModifytheDOMChangetheURLintheaddressbar 关于javascri
背景我目前正在使用Google的#!方法通过代理和PhantomJS的组合为一个动态网站设置SEO索引。我们的Web应用程序不仅托管我们自己的应用程序,还托管由第三方提供的任意数量的应用程序。由于我无法控制这些应用程序(因此无法控制它们的加载时间),因此在处理GoogleBot查询时我现在面临两种选择:缓存生成的HTML并将缓存的响应返回给GoogleBot。在每次GoogleBot请求时刷新缓存,但返回陈旧的响应使用基于时间的缓存机制。到期时,GoogleBot会收到新生成的响应显然我更愿意选择(2),但我担心GoogleBot在读取已抓取的HTML之前会超时。问题GoogleBot
我正在调查我管理的网站上的问题。发生的事情是,当您从Google查看网站的缓存版本(文本版本)时,它没有显示某些子导航链接。我不太确定谷歌机器人如何找到这些链接,但我看不出我的标记有任何问题。这是我用于导航的代码片段:homeStyleModernTraditionalColorBlueRed“主页”和“样式”链接会被Google拾取,但“现代”和“传统”链接不会。我使用JavaScript来显示/隐藏子菜单,但这肯定不会导致Google不获取这些链接吗?在其他网站上,我看到Google获取了使用JavaScript显示的导航项上的链接。这可能与我的两个子菜单ul元素具有相同ID的事实
我开发了一个以非ajax页面为核心的网站,然后是一个带有url的分支http://mywebsite.com/frameworks/#!ajaxpageaddress1http://mywebsite.com/frameworks/#!ajaxpageaddress2我已将网站设置为在从Google抓取工具接收到_escaped_fragment_时传送html快照。我已经使用fetchasgoogle测试了ajax页面,它可以正确返回html快照。我已经提交了带有hashbang地址的站点地图。我已按照找到的每条说明进行操作,但谷歌仅索引非ajax页面(但未记录任何抓取错误)。有没有
给定一个来自a.com的页面:Test尽管是否会抓取链接?节点没有内容? 最佳答案 会被抓取吗?可能,鉴于上面的例子。它会被索引和/或排名吗?这取决于是否有值得排名的内容。您能发送有关b.com的排名信号吗?没有。 关于seo-googlebot会抓取一个空的A节点吗?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/26724276/
我在DNN网站上为博客、新闻文章等使用EasyDNN新闻模块。核心DNN站点地图不包含此模块生成的文章,但模块会创建自己的站点地图。例如:domain.com/blog/mid/1005/ctl/sitemap当我尝试将此站点地图提交给Google时,它说我的Robots.txt文件阻止了它。查看DNN附带的Robots.txt文件,我注意到Slurp和Googlebot用户代理下的以下几行:Disallow:/*/ctl/#Slurppermits*Disallow:/*/ctl/#Googlebotpermits*我想提交模块的站点地图,但我想知道为什么这些用户代理不允许/ct
我正在尝试为我的主干应用程序使用预渲染服务,让我的页面在谷歌上编入索引。当我专门将googlebot添加到用户代理列表时,我知道设置工作正常,但有人建议我不要这样做,而建议使用_escaped_fragment_方法。唯一的问题是_escaped_fragment_参数没有正确传递。可以帮忙吗?谢谢!!!#html5pushstate(history)support:RewriteEngineOnRewriteCond%{HTTP_HOST}^example\.com$[OR]RewriteCond%{HTTPS}!onRewriteRule^(.*)$https://www.exam